2) What do I have to offer to customers?
- My umbrella rental service will feature a variety of pick-up/drop-off locations strategically place over a given area with large amounts of pedestrian traffic. For example, on campus some potential locations for a pick-up/drop-off bucket would be at the exits to a lecture hall, entrances/exits to the Reitz Union and all libaries, major bus stops, etc. I can see this concept expanding on an international scale, moving to points of attraction like outdoor malls/outlets, airports, bus stops. and business districts.
3) Who am I offering this too?
- Just about everyone that could benefit from my umbrella rental service moves from one building to another by walking on a daily basis.
4) Why?
- For a small fee every month or by every use, people dressed in business attire with valuable technology on their persons are often inconvenienced by rain. People in Florida dread the spontaneity of Florida rain, yet we still do not have a set solution for those moving around campus on foot. Many people bring their own umbrella or use a rainjacket, but these types of items are hard to store away or dry quickly before entering a new building. My umbrella rental service would give people access to a simple solution that they can dispose of quickly before entering a building.
